    Question about peptide storing

    So I'm having the same issues as everyone else as far as pinning multiple times and dull needles. My solution was to reconstitute one vial of cjc and draw the entire vial up in one slin pin then reconstitute the ipam and draw it up in one slin pin. So now I have 2 slin pins both full. So when I pin I just backload one slin and then put both full slin pins back in fridge. My question is, is this safe to do and I want to make sure I'm not degrading the peps by storing them in syringes. Any of you guys do it like this or have any input?

    I just want to clarify guys...to necro and Ryan...I am not using the same pin every time. I reconstitute each vail, then I take two syringes and draw the entire contents of each vial into the two syringes respectively. So now I have one full slin pin of cjc and one full slin pin of ipam. Ok...now these are stored in the fridge. When I get ready to dose and inject, I take the two syringes out of fridge and take an UNUSED syringe and backload it with the correct doses from each syringe. Then I put the two syringes, one full of cjc and one full of ipam, back in the fridge until next dose. So everytime I dose I'm using a brand spankin new slin pin and I discard after use. My only concern, which I think it's perfectly fine to do, is storing the two peps in slin pins instead of the vials. And you guys might want to try this also, makes dosing very easy, keeps slin pins sharp, and keeps you from accidentally mixing the two peps when you draw from each vial. It's the way to go IMO.
